Key Evaluation Metrics for Drone Battery Suppliers
When you’re in the late stages of drone battery selection, you need a focused approach to supplier evaluation. Here are the essential metrics to prioritize:
- Quality Certifications and Compliance: Verify if the supplier holds relevant certifications such as ISO 9001, UL, CE, and specific drone battery safety standards. A reliable supplier should provide documentation proving compliance with these standards. - Track Record of On-Time Deliveries: Request delivery performance data for the past 18 months. A reliable supplier should have a minimum 95% on-time delivery rate. Ask for case studies from similar B2B clients in your industry.
- Technical Support Capabilities: Evaluate the supplier’s technical support team’s responsiveness and expertise. A reliable supplier should offer 24/7 technical support with a dedicated account manager, especially crucial for industrial applications like offshore wind farm maintenance drones.
- Scalability and Flexibility: Assess the supplier’s ability to scale production as your needs grow. A reliable supplier should have the capacity to handle volume increases without compromising quality or delivery times.
- Financial Stability: Check the supplier’s financial health through credit reports or financial statements. A financially stable supplier is less likely to face disruptions in supply.
- Customer References: Contact at least three recent clients with similar requirements to get an unbiased perspective on the supplier’s reliability.
- Warranty and After-Sales Support: A reliable supplier should offer comprehensive warranties (typically 12-24 months) and robust after-sales support, including battery recycling programs and performance monitoring.

Practical Evaluation Tools and Methods
To effectively evaluate drone battery suppliers in the late decision-making phase, consider implementing these practical tools and methods:
- Supplier Scorecard: Create a scorecard with weighted criteria based on your specific needs. For example, if delivery time is critical for your drone operations, assign it a higher weight than price. Use a 1-5 scale for each criterion and calculate a total score.
- Reference Verification Process: Develop a standardized reference verification process. Ask specific questions like “What was the supplier’s response time to technical issues?”, “Did they meet delivery commitments?”, and “How did they handle quality issues?”
- Battery Performance Testing: Conduct a small-scale battery performance test with the supplier’s samples. Test for:
- Discharge rates under simulated operational conditions
- Safety under extreme temperatures
- Cycle life performance
- Weight and size compatibility
- Supply Chain Analysis: Request a detailed overview of the supplier’s supply chain. A reliable supplier should have multiple sources for critical components to mitigate supply chain risks.
- Financial Health Check: Use tools like Dun & Bradstreet or local business credit reports to assess the supplier’s financial stability.
- Contract Review: Have legal counsel review the supplier’s contract terms, especially regarding delivery timelines, quality guarantees, and termination clauses.

Transforming Evaluation Results into Strategic Decisions
The final step in late-stage supplier evaluation is transforming your findings into a strategic decision. Here’s how to do it effectively:
- Prioritize Based on Risk: Rank potential suppliers based on the risk of failure. A supplier with strong quality certifications but a weaker delivery record might be acceptable if your primary concern is battery performance, but not if your project has tight deadlines.
- Consider Total Cost of Ownership: Don’t just look at the price per battery. Consider the total cost of ownership, including potential costs from delays, rework, and safety incidents.
- Build in Contingency Plans: Even with a reliable supplier, have contingency plans in place. For example, maintain a small inventory of critical batteries or identify a secondary supplier.
